CS 245: Programming Graphical User Interfaces
4.00 Credits
California State Polytechnic University-Pomona
Computer interfaces. Usability of interactive systems. GUI development processes. GUI components. Input and viewing devices. Eventhandling. Animation use in GUIs. Problemsolving techniques. 4 lectures. Prerequisite: CS 141 with a grade of C or better, or consent of instructor.

CS 256: C++ Programming
4.00 Credits
California State Polytechnic University-Pomona
Class encapsulation, inheritance, polymorphism, object storage management, and exception handling. Standard template library including template classes and generic algorithms. Software reuse and objectoriented programming. 4 lectures/problemsolving. Prerequisite: CS 128 or CS 141 with a grade of C or better, or consent of instructor.

CS 264: Computer Organization and Assembly Programming
4.00 Credits
California State Polytechnic University-Pomona
Von Neumann machine. Instruction set architecture. Addressing modes. Assembly programming. Arrays and records. Subroutines and macros. I/O and interrupts. Interfacing and communication. 4 lectures/problemsolving. Prerequisites: CS 210 and CS 240 with grades of C or better, or consent of instructor.

CS 301: Numerical Methods
4.00 Credits
California State Polytechnic University-Pomona
Error analysis, zeros of a function, systems of linear equations, interpolation, Chebyshev approximation, least squares approximation, numerical integration and differentiation, random processes. 4 lectures/problemsolving. Prerequisites: MAT 208 and MAT 214 and either CS 125 or CS 240 with grades of C or better, or consent of instructor.

CS 311: Language Translation and Automata
4.00 Credits
California State Polytechnic University-Pomona
Introduction to language translation. Regular expressions. Finite automata. Lexical analysis. Contextfree grammars and push down automata. Syntax analysis. 4 lectures/problemsolving. Prerequisite: CS 241 with a grade of C or better, or consent of instructor.

CS 331: Design and Analysis of Algorithms
4.00 Credits
California State Polytechnic University-Pomona
Algorithm design techniques including divideandconquer, the greedy method, dynamic programming, backtracking, and branchandbound. Analysis of sorting and searching. Tractability. Complexity analysis using basic asymptotic notation. Prerequisites: CS 241 and MAT 208 with grades of C or better, or consent of instructor.

CS 356: ObjectOriented Design and Programming
4.00 Credits
California State Polytechnic University-Pomona
Elements of the object model. Abstraction, encapsulation, modularity and hierarchy. Structural and behavioral diagrams. Implementation and programming of system design. Comprehensive examples using a case study approach. 4 lectures/problemsolving. Prerequisite: CS 241 with a grade of C or better, or consent of instructor.

CS 365: Computer Architecture
4.00 Credits
California State Polytechnic University-Pomona
Data representations. Computer arithmetic. Data path and control unit design. Pipelining. Memory technology and hierarchy. I/O devices and interfacing. Multiprocessing and alternative architectures. 4 lectures/ problemsolving. Prerequisite: CS 264 with a grade of C or better, or consent of instructor.
